#1db603 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1db603 is composed of 11.4% red, 71.4%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.4%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 111.3 degrees, a saturation of 96.8% and a lightness of 36.3%. #1db603 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ff06 with #006d00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

Shades and Tints of #1db603

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010800 is the darkest color, while #f6fff4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1db603

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5a6158 is the less saturated color, while #1db603 is the most saturated one.
